Benefits of a Walking Standing Desk

A walking standing desk is a workstation that incorporates an under-desk treadmill. These are more expensive than standard desks but they offer several benefits worth the money.

Regular exercise has been proven to improve immunity, which results in lower levels of illness and absenteeism. It can also help reduce stress levels.

Increased Energy

It's not a secret that sitting for prolonged periods of time can lead to energy crashes, making it difficult to focus and complete tasks. A walking desk can help combat this problem by introducing activity and movement into the workday. The treadmill's gentle movements keep the body's systems energized and pumped throughout the day.

Walking also improves blood circulation, which helps deliver oxygen and nutrients to the muscles and brain. This boost in energy will help you remain alert, focused and productive throughout the day.

A life of sedentary has been linked with a myriad of health issues and a lower life lifespan. By reducing the amount of time you spend sitting and encouraging moderate exercise, treadmill desks can help improve your performance and health.

Research has shown that working at a treadmill desk can reduce the risk of developing diabetes, heart disease, obesity, and high blood pressure. In addition to these physical advantages, it has been shown that working on a treadmill can boost cognitive performance and reduce employee absenteeism.

Some people worry that they will become too exhausted when using a treadmill desk, but this is not usually the situation. The steady pace of walking keeps muscles active and fueled. Many users report that they can walk for more than 5 miles in one day without feeling exhausted.

Treadmill desks are expensive however they are well worth the investment. They allow you to sit, stand, and walk all day long based on your mood and your personal goals. They are particularly beneficial for those who have limited space, as they can be used in place of the traditional height-adjustable or standing desk.

It may take some time to become comfortable walking and working simultaneously. Training tasks that require fine motor skills or a high level of concentration while on the treadmill can be challenging, and it's recommended to use a programmable keyboard and mouse to make it simpler. Despite these issues, LeCheminant and Larson found that the increased health benefits of a treadmill desk are greater than any negative effects on productivity.

Better Blood Flow

Sedentary work for long periods can trigger a range of health issues, such as back and neck pain. A walking pad and standing desk standing desk allows you to move about throughout the day and relieves these issues by enhancing blood circulation throughout your body. A treadmill underneath your desk will also assist in burning calories, which will improve your overall health and wellbeing.

Research suggests that the best way to increase productivity is to incorporate movement into your working day. Studies also show that your brain performs better when you're moving and working your muscles. In fact, one study showed that participants completing tasks that required fine motor skills performed 20 percent less well sitting down than those who were moving while working.

Moving around can increase blood flow to the brain, which can help you concentrate and think clearly. Walking during the day helps you remain alert and focused on your work and helps reduce the common ailments that are associated with prolonged periods of sedentary work, including poor blood circulation leading to swollen ankles, varicose veins, and even blood clots.

Another benefit of using a treadmill desk is that it can help to alleviate back and neck pain. The standing position allows your spine to elongate and ease pressure on your spinal discs. But, you should be careful and follow proper ergonomics when incorporating standing desks into your work routine. Being too sedentary can cause the back region of the lumbar spine to become compressed, which can put strain on the lower back and shoulders. When you sit in a seated position, the curve of your spine may be increased, which can result in discomfort in your neck and back. Standing can ease the pain by relieving the pressure on your spine while still allowing you to use good posture and keep a straight back.

While you can use the treadmill while sitting down, most treadmill desks are built to accommodate a computer desk and monitor. They may not be as solid as a traditional desk and this could affect your ability to do certain tasks that require a higher level of fine motor skills. Additionally, the continuous movement of a treadmill desk could be distracting for coworkers, and it can interfere with your concentration. Therefore, it is important to use a treadmill desk only in areas where you are able to work comfortably with people around you.

Creativity Boosted

The act of standing and walking is a vigorous and stimulating way to increase creativity. We are used to viewing our work from the sea level perspective when we sit (except for what is at our desks). However, when you get from your chair and walk to your desk, you're suddenly able see your ideas from a new perspective, like you're on a balcony overlooking the world below. This new visual perspective can spark all sorts of creative ideas and thoughts.

Exercise has been linked to increased creativity. In a study in which participants were given an object and asked to brainstorm ways to make the object used, test subjects who took a stroll after their exercise had up to 60% more uses for the object than those who remained at their desks.

Sitting for a long time can have a negative effect on the brain and make it difficult to concentrate and think clearly. If you choose to use a walking standing desk, the movement and blood flow help you to focus better and gives your brain a small boost to help you think more creatively.

A Latvian startup said that its employees who used standing desks with a walking path saw a 10% increase of productivity. This was in addition to other health benefits that are well-known from a walking office including less fatigue and stress.

Standing desks foster creativity, which is why more businesses are shifting to them. This new office trend is now spreading to schools, where groups like Stand Up Kids try to convince schools that standing for hours at work is the most effective method for children to learn.

While some of the research about standing and productivity has been somewhat mixed, the majority of experts agree that the overall trend is positive. Dan Kois, reporter for New York Magazine tried to complete a month in his standing desk and called it the "most productive month of my lifetime". The benefits of a walking desk are obvious.

Reduce Stress

Researchers have discovered that when you're active during the day, it can help to reduce stress levels. This is because exercise promotes blood flow and stimulates your brain. In turn, it aids in improving your focus and improves your cognitive performance. It also helps improve your mood and reduce the risk of certain health conditions.

If you don't have a treadmill desk, you can enjoy the same benefits using a standing desk. It is important to ensure your lumbar spine is properly supported and that the desk is elevated enough to allow you to be able to comfortably view your computer screen without needing to bend or tilt it.

It is also important to take into consideration your space, and whether it is able to accommodate a desk chair. Some standing desks have adjustable heights, making it easier to change from sitting to standing throughout the day. Other options include desk convertors which allow you to sit while working on the standing desk, or treadmill-based workstations that can be moved upwards and downwards so that you can sit or stand.

Certain studies have proven that those who work on treadmills walking desks are able to finish their work more efficiently than those who do not. This is because those who exercise while working are able to concentrate on their tasks and maintain a steady level of activity. Other studies have found that using a treadmill at work can reduce the amount time that employees sit down which can cause serious health issues.

It is crucial to remember that more research is required to better understand these types of workplace interventions. This includes those that require active desks like treadmill desks. Studies that use randomization, more extended follow-up periods and larger samples sizes will help determine the ways in which these workplace fitness programs can positively impact the health of employees.
